Title: | An educational process for requirements extraction and use case modeling based on problem-based learning and knowledge acquisition |
Author: | Vasques, D.G. Galindo, J.F. Dos Santos, G.S. Gomes, F.D. Garcia-Nunes, P.I. Martins, P.S. |
Abstract: | The performance of Software Engineering professionals is related,among other factors, to adequate knowledge management practices.Specifically, business vision modeling, requirements, and use-caseextraction are central elements in Software Engineering, since theyreflect the needs, specificities and functionalities to be consideredat the software development stage. All these activities are relatedto knowledge acquisition and modeling. The goal of this work is toimplement an educational process based on knowledge acquisitionthat assists in more dynamic and active pedagogical practices. Thisprocess was tested with software engineering students. The resultsshowed advantages in the adoption of a strategy using principles ofknowledge acquisition and modeling. It is possible to conclude thatthe introduction of the process in the classroom improves students'performance in business vision modeling and in the extraction ofuse cases and requirements |
